Florida’s Sexual Assault Laws cover a range of offenses, from non-consensual sexual contact to exploitation and distribution of intimate images without consent. These laws are designed to protect individuals’ autonomy and bodily integrity. For instance, under Florida Statute 794.011, sexual assault is defined as any form of sexual penetration or sexual act committed by force, threat, coercion, or manipulation. A sexual assault attorney Florida can help interpret these statutes, ensuring victims understand their options and the potential outcomes. One key aspect is the statute of limitations—victims have a limited time to file charges, typically within 7 years of the incident, as per Florida Statute 775.15.

One crucial aspect of recovery is accessing specialized care. Florida offers various non-profit organizations and community centers dedicated to assisting sexual assault victims. These facilities provide confidential services such as crisis counseling, medical examinations, legal advocacy, and support groups. For instance, organizations like RAINN (Rape, Abuse & Incest National Network) have local affiliates across the state, offering a national helpline and in-person support. Additionally, many hospitals have sexual assault response teams (SARTs) equipped to handle physical and emotional trauma, ensuring survivors receive immediate care and support.
